NHL: Blue Jackets vs New Jersey Devils Prediction 11/24/2023

The Columbus Blue Jackets (5-11-4) travel to face off against the New Jersey Devils (8-8-1) on Friday, November 24th. This game will be played at Prudential Center in Newark and televised on ESPN+. The Blue Jackets are coming off a win in their previous game, while the Devils are looking to get back on track from a loss to the Red Wings. Puck drop is set for 3:00 ET.

Columbus Blue Jackets vs New Jersey Devils

The Columbus Blue Jackets Are Coming Off A Win

This season, the Blue Jackets have a mark of 5-11-4. When going on the road, Columbus has a record of 1-5-3 record, while they are 4-6-1 at their home arena. At the moment, they hold the 8th spot in the Eastern Metropolitan division and are ranked 16th in the Eastern conference. Looking at Columbus’ average scoring margin, it is -0.8, which has led to a puck line record of 4-16. When playing at home, their scoring margin is -0.5, and on the road, it is -1.1.

The Blue Jackets most recently faced the Blackhawks at home and achieved a 7-3 win. Looking at the Blue Jackets offense vs. the Blackhawks, they managed to score three goals in the opening period and four times in the second period. Of Columbus’ seven goals, one came while in power play. They ended the game with 26 shots on goal and had seven giveaways.

Columbus secured a win against the puck line, entering the game as the favorites with a -1.5 goal advantage. With a combined total of 10 goals, the teams exceeded the over/under line of 6.5 goals set for the game.

The New Jersey Devils Look To Bounce Back From A Loss

Coming into their game vs. Blue Jackets, the Devils have a 8-8-1 record. They hold a 3-4-1 record when playing at home, and they have gone 5-4-0 on the road. Their current record places them 7th in the Eastern Metropolitan division and 14th in the Eastern conference. New Jersey heads into the game with four wins by more than one goal, and lost seven games by multiple goals. Their overall puck line record this season is 4-13.

Following a 4-0 loss on the road to the Red Wings, the Devils are eager to bounce back. The Red Wings defense proved to be too much for New Jersey’s offense, resulting in being shutout. During the game, the Devils’ offense had 6 turnovers and took 16 shots on goal while being shutout.

New Jersey took a loss vs. the puck line in the game, going into the game favored by -1.5. The game ended below the over/under line of 6.5, with a combined total of 4 goals.

Columbus Offense Breakdown

In terms of their offensive performance, the Blue Jackets are averaging 2.9 goals per game this season, putting them in the 18th spot in the NHL. When it comes to shots on goal per game, they are ranked 5th in the league. Looking at how the Blue Jackets’ offense is performing during power plays, they are 29th in power play goals and 30th in shorthanded goals.

So far, the Blue Jackets have an over/under record of 12-8-0. Coming into the game, they have played 12 games that went beyond the 6.5 over/under line. Their games, on average, had 6.6 goals per game.

New Jersey Offense Breakdown

On offense, the Devils are averaging 3.5 goals per game which is 15th in the NHL. In terms of shots on goal per game, they are 24th in the league. In terms of power play goals, the Devils offense is 1st in power play goals. As for shorthanded goals, they are 16th in the NHL.

This season, the over/under record for the Devils’ is 13-4-0. Over the course of the season, they have had 13 games that exceeded the over/under line of 6.5. On average, their games are averaging 7.4 goals per game.

Columbus Team Defense

Coming into the game, the Blue Jackets’ defense is 20th in takeaways at 5.6 takeaways per contest. Overall, they are giving up 3.3 goals per game which is 3rd in the NHL.

New Jersey Team Defense

The Devils’ defense comes into the game with a ranking of 19th in takeaways and an average of 6.6 takeaways per contest. They hold 25th place in the NHL for goals allowed, with an average of 3.4 goals given up per game.
